La storia

Turner was 70 when he painted this, near the end of a long career, and his ships and seas had dissolved into light and vapour to the point where many viewers no longer knew what they were looking at. He had a specific buyer in mind, Elhanan Bicknell, a collector who had made a fortune in whale oil, and he even worked the subject up from a real book, Thomas Beale's natural history of the sperm whale. The gamble did not pay off. Bicknell returned the picture to him. It is one of four whaling scenes Turner made in these years, an old man watching a violent industry, the whale itself barely there, more a disturbance in the haze than a beast.
